What is driving the change
Plausible drivers include the rapid embedding of generative AI features into search engines, browsers, and retail platforms; younger consumers' greater baseline comfort with conversational and chat-based interfaces from other parts of their digital lives; growing fatigue with cluttered search results and sponsored listings; and a broader cultural normalization of asking AI tools for recommendations across domains beyond shopping. These are reasoned inferences from the shape of the claim itself rather than confirmed causal findings.

What is changing
The behavioural claim itself describes a shift in how shopping discovery happens. Historically, the dominant discovery mechanisms for consumer purchases have been search-engine queries, retailer and marketplace search bars, comparison-shopping sites, review aggregation, and social recommendation — all of which route the consumer through a sequence of manual searching, filtering, and comparing. The emerging behaviour described here is different in kind: consumers engaging a conversational or generative AI assistant as an intermediary in that process, asking it to recommend, compare, or narrow options, rather than performing that work themselves through traditional search interfaces. The distinctive element of this particular claim is not simply that AI-assisted shopping is emerging — that is a broadly plausible extension of generative AI's spread into consumer tools — but that the claim specifies an age gradient, with younger cohorts showing a stronger preference for this mode than older ones. That generational framing is what gives the claim its shape and its testability: it is not simply asserting that AI shopping assistants exist or are used, but that adoption is uneven across age groups in a specific direction consistent with typical technology-diffusion patterns.
Why this matters
If a meaningful shift toward AI-mediated shopping discovery is underway, and if it is concentrated among younger consumers, the implications compound over time rather than being static. Younger cohorts today become the primary shopping demographic of the next decade, so a discovery-channel shift that starts among them is structurally more consequential than one distributed evenly across ages, because it suggests a generational replacement dynamic rather than a temporary novelty adopted evenly and then abandoned. For retailers, brands, and the broader digital marketing ecosystem, discovery channel shifts of this kind have historically preceded significant reallocations of investment — as happened with the earlier shifts from print and broadcast advertising toward search, and later from search toward social and marketplace advertising. An AI-assistant-mediated discovery layer, if it develops at scale, would sit between the consumer and the retailer in a way that owned search and merchandising do not fully control, raising questions about who curates recommendations, how products get surfaced to an AI assistant, and whether today's search-engine-optimization and retail-media playbooks transfer to that environment. Even at this early and unconfirmed stage, the claim is significant enough, if true, to warrant attention from any organisation whose growth depends on being discovered at the moment of purchase intent.
